Postby J2Kbr » Mon Mar 04, 2019 1:40 pm

SirrapT wrote:Please leave the basic advice out, I tried it all. This one is COMPLETELY DEAD! I read a few other posts with the same problem and there seam to be no answer?

If you haven't tried yet, please re-flash the firmware using the recovery mode, as explained here:

http://www.consoletuner.com/kbase/firmw ... y_mode.htm

It may be necessary double press the reset button to enter in the programing mode (P).

After some serious digging and researching in this matter (all online reviews I could find), my conclusion is as follows (have in mind that I have used the T1 only, and just for 6 months):

Titan One and Two is (in my opinion) a superior concept that is amazing and extremely useful for most of us gamers.

When we start to understand more about the code language (script) ourselves, it's even more amazing.

Thanks to the professional support, most requests are made possible.

The physical part of this concept/product, is the only weak point I can find so far. High risk of wear and tear and possibly even overheating, and even more so if not unplugged ("turned off") when not in use.

Me myself, coming from Sweden (now a resident of Texas), had a hard time getting used to the short warranty times you guys have here. 90 days is very common here, compared to consumers rights for 1 - 2 years in Sweden. In other words, in the US, the quality of the product don't need to last longer than 3 - 4 months? Something to be aware of I suppose!

I might be wrong, or missing something here, but my advice is:
Buy a short USB extension (1 - 2 feet), plug this in the console and then put the T1 in the extention. This way there's no risk for pushing and bending on the T1. I have an external pc fan on top of (air out flow) my Xbox One. If you want some cooling on the T1, place it on top of the external fan (tape or something) and there you go. And always unplug while not in use! This should make it last longer...
